The Human Resources Generalist supports the full scope of HR responsibilities, including employee records management, recruitment, onboarding, benefits administration, leave management, and compliance. This role also plays a key part in promoting employee engagement and ensuring HR practices align with organizational goals, policies, and applicable laws.
Maintain accurate and confidential employee records, ensuring compliance with company policies and regulatory requirements.
Support the recruitment process by posting job openings, screening applicants, coordinating interviews, conducting reference checks, and managing background screenings.
Facilitate hiring processes for hourly and salaried employees, including scheduling assessments when required.
Communicate company policies, benefits, and HR procedures to employees and candidates.
Administer employee benefits, workers' compensation, FMLA, STD, and other leave programs, ensuring timely and accurate processing.
Track, monitor, and manage employee leave balances and related documentation.
Prepare and maintain HR reports, metrics, and documentation as needed.
Partner with managers and employees to address HR-related questions and provide guidance.
Support employee engagement initiatives, such as recognition programs, employee surveys, and communication efforts to foster a positive work culture.
